But first, a small background of the magnificent timepiece:

The watch is a Montblanc 4810 Chronograph Automatic that usually retails for roughly around 400,000/- Kshs.

  • Ident No: 114856
  • Calibre: MB 25.07
  • Movement Type: Automatic chronograph
  • Case Size: 41-43 mm
  • Material: Stainless steel
  • Diameter: 43 mm
